summ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orArf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org>2010-11-07 15:47:35 +0000
committerArf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org>2010-11-07 15:47:35 +0000
commit34b24bad4e25608d75029e0bda64955baa853ded (patch)
tree1fda1e0c5c4d3fe15c1447aaf3353665d3691a9b /dev-python/apsw
parentDelete older ebuilds. (diff)
downloadhistorical-34b24bad4e25608d75029e0bda64955baa853ded.tar.gz
historical-34b24bad4e25608d75029e0bda64955baa853ded.tar.bz2
historical-34b24bad4e25608d75029e0bda64955baa853ded.zip
Version bump. Enable support for loadable sqlite extensions.
Package-Manager: portage-2.2.0_alpha4_p12/cvs/Linux x86_64
Diffstat (limited to 'dev-python/apsw')
-rw-r--r--dev-python/apsw/ChangeLog8
-rw-r--r--dev-python/apsw/Manifest18
-rw-r--r--dev-python/apsw/apsw-3.7.3.1.ebuild52
3 files changed, 62 insertions, 16 deletions
diff --git a/dev-python/apsw/ChangeLog b/dev-python/apsw/ChangeLog
index 3ee3deb25757..4f8f331b75ef 100644
--- a/dev-python/apsw/ChangeLog
+++ b/dev-python/apsw/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-python/apsw
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-python/apsw/ChangeLog,v 1.32 2010/10/25 00:26:07 fauli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-python/apsw/ChangeLog,v 1.33 2010/11/07 15:47:35 arfrever Exp $
+
+*apsw-3.7.3.1 (07 Nov 2010)
+
+ 07 Nov 2010;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org>
+ -apsw-3.6.23.1.1.ebuild, -apsw-3.7.0.1.ebuild, +apsw-3.7.3.1.ebuild:
+ Version bump. Enable support for loadable sqlite extensions.
25 Oct 2010; Christian Faulhammer <fauli@gentoo.org> apsw-3.7.2.1.ebuild:
stable x86, bug 342325
diff --git a/dev-python/apsw/Manifest b/dev-python/apsw/Manifest
index 3328101f9a4c..8dacc07ccce8 100644
--- a/dev-python/apsw/Manifest
+++ b/dev-python/apsw/Manifest
@@ -1,19 +1,7 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
AUX apsw-3.6.20.1-fix_tests.patch 336 RMD160 000fca2da306de12102e7b5e6c082ffb6292f36d SHA1 b9e203462a78f6709519cac3e15ad0974294309c SHA256 87cafad98bbdeeed0cfe82ca98b2f7fa9768793535abb1bc7562de8c52f2adb1
-DIST apsw-3.6.23.1-r1.zip 541009 RMD160 324b895af53bee1a7a91656f5c518cfc868b36a4 SHA1 de114b6e86a2fbc93fd0507e2e0515ab8cf96072 SHA256 2aa4dc1ecded3620add62ded442840faa114c6c6fe6987bdf7a3ab6c84cd8b7e
-DIST apsw-3.7.0-r1.zip 563160 RMD160 220ae71e69dcc8fa0d62303302263358ce155b2f SHA1 87560a5bd531ee5e1135263c3047f66c0e9d3f33 SHA256 2b6c46fe4139a988d9531961ebb3705c77774e0e45b4f0e5869e60fe277df99e
DIST apsw-3.7.2-r1.zip 586131 RMD160 8435c50481ba997d635684da80471fc6923f3e15 SHA1 989ec5a45ba5572cb83356b2d3e0f8f4f0b80e61 SHA256 fe28cd578d0d821b1783e6b934a1dc33b49ce2e084542d168fa1bdb465ff0416
-EBUILD apsw-3.6.23.1.1.ebuild 1040 RMD160 6f539bc7bf6fe5bed980fdf57428a4b5cbffcddb SHA1 1d1825059763dcc0d082052d34991080425ecc05 SHA256 cc0338f917a2911e13c0454af8bdcda0b6077a95b90fc35e5d253b26da11d1f2
-EBUILD apsw-3.7.0.1.ebuild 1079 RMD160 22c56954c8173000b0f8fcaec84994985f41df6b SHA1 07f97b1ee6666801558406c6b4a05ce192aaaebe SHA256 b547564bedfe38a54e0fc28473463417a51134f380bd12477fede7083de210f0
+DIST apsw-3.7.3-r1.zip 588851 RMD160 c94bb5433f1da9705c4c208f8b2ca855514026cc SHA1 a84094dd1b5b9ca576e0d433631a28daa8776442 SHA256 1fd666f00a969129c7a77d4503fcfed7956192493a0685b80d6af209f6d27f54
EBUILD apsw-3.7.2.1.ebuild 1104 RMD160 6dfa3a560132b49c08942e1bd54b043a65bca281 SHA1 b62c24c558cb9f03a8d67321d0346224c9eaaa46 SHA256 b5d276c68b32a191148cae6b01e14a357aab52693b68c771addff6d35d9d9981
-MISC ChangeLog 4425 RMD160 882e54e016b45e94f9441078b80059fe6c0f41bd SHA1 6232b12ef5998f3fb900b183f4b10dabfd53495e SHA256 332762e3167df3a32e084a2ec389564ea12fa403a6b6c0b918b27a35b8c0b871
+EBUILD apsw-3.7.3.1.ebuild 1317 RMD160 c7c28441f32d717eecd0b72a9f11c793dd85d7cc SHA1 fab185610cdaf09f4617499f249d0aa3da0f698e SHA256 1db70f8cbb31c48dee6df2dab4380b04fabdb74217dd893e20b47288d6ef759e
+MISC ChangeLog 4665 RMD160 2bdc9c1242770e8147a1031fb448031c36abdd7b SHA1 57a2d6dd0f7dc8c75d8d103cbd40d81c8058c18b SHA256 7c77c9ba037c5ae2f88cf3e47b6a1ba3c2784b742f0e9fa1e906a5fce90909e7
MISC metadata.xml 521 RMD160 46536dbaba8b078be569ccd226937c9ba8ae6e27 SHA1 79604d199b1674bdbf823380e6aac6f325ff3252 SHA256 d860d4be70d9a1797a97977de55a00abdb0dd58a6bb06afd94f90de5ac97d88e
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.16 (GNU/Linux)
-
-iEYEARECAAYFAkzEzzwACgkQNQqtfCuFneOjjQCfa5u7a62IkYfxvGYYixZqbVbD
-HC8An1TF8krTcpK2WDTEhqGQz1vO2bWm
-=soCI
------END PGP SIGNATURE-----
diff --git a/dev-python/apsw/apsw-3.7.3.1.ebuild b/dev-python/apsw/apsw-3.7.3.1.ebuild
new file mode 100644
index 000000000000..21ef420f914f
--- /dev/null
+++ b/dev-python/apsw/apsw-3.7.3.1.ebuild
@@ -0,0 +1,52 @@
+# Copyright 1999-2010 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/apsw/apsw-3.7.3.1.ebuild,v 1.1 2010/11/07 15:47:34 arfrever Exp $
+
+EAPI="3"
+SUPPORT_PYTHON_ABIS="1"
+
+inherit distutils eutils versionator
+
+MY_PV="$(replace_version_separator 3 -r)"
+
+DESCRIPTION="APSW - Another Python SQLite Wrapper"
+HOMEPAGE="http://code.google.com/p/apsw/"
+SRC_URI="http://apsw.googlecode.com/files/${PN}-${MY_PV}.zip"
+
+LICENSE="as-is"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c64 ~x86"
+IUSE=""
+
+RDEPEND=">=dev-db/sqlite-$(get_version_component_range 1-3)[extensions]"
+DEPEND="${RDEPEND}
+ app-arch/unzip"
+
+S="${WORKDIR}/${PN}-${MY_PV}"
+
+PYTHON_CFLAGS=("2.* + -fno-strict-aliasing")
+
+src_prepare() {
+ distutils_src_prepare
+ epatch "${FILESDIR}/${PN}-3.6.20.1-fix_tests.patch"
+}
+
+src_compile() {
+ distutils_src_compile --enable=load_extension
+}
+
+src_test() {
+ echo "$(PYTHON -f)" setup.py build_test_extension
+ "$(PYTHON -f)" setup.py build_test_extension || die "Building of test loadable extension failed"
+
+ testing() {
+ PYTHONPATH="$(ls -d build-${PYTHON_ABI}/lib.*)" "$(PYTHON)" tests.py -v
+ }
+ python_execute_function testing
+}
+
+src_install() {
+ distutils_src_install
+ dodoc doc/_sources/* || die "dodoc failed"
+ dohtml -r doc/* || die "dohtml failed"
+}